membershipgrade.html
8.54 KB
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
170
171
172
173
174
175
176
177
178
179
180
181
182
{template 'common/header'}
{template 'common'}
<ul class="nav nav-tabs">
<li {if $operation == 'list'}class="active"{/if}><a href="{php echo create_url('site/entry', array('do' => 'charge', 'op' => 'list','m' => 'wwx_fxxt','uniacid'=>$_W['uniacid']))}">会员管理</a></li>
<li {if $operation == 'display'}class="active"{/if}><a href="{php echo $this->createWebUrl('membershipgrade', array('op' => 'display'))}">等级管理</a></li>
{if $operation == 'post'}<li class="active"><a>{if !empty($membership['id'])}编辑{else}添加{/if}会员等级</a></li>{/if}
</ul>
{if $operation == 'post'}
<div class="main">
<div class="panel panel-info">
<div class="panel-heading">{if !empty($membership['id'])}编辑{else}添加{/if}会员等级</div>
<div class="panel-body">
<form action="./index.php" method="get" class="form-horizontal" role="form" id="form1" onsubmit="return formcheck(this)">
<input type="hidden" name="id" value="{$membership['id']}" />
<input type="hidden" name="c" value="site" />
<input type="hidden" name="a" value="entry" />
<input type="hidden" name="m" value="wwx_fxxt" />
<input type="hidden" name="do" value="membershipgrade" />
<input type="hidden" name="op" value="post" />
<div class="form-group">
<label class="col-xs-12 col-sm-3 col-md-2 control-label">等级级别</label>
<div class="col-sm-1 col-xs-12">
<input type="text" name="displayorder" id="displayorder" onkeyup="value=this.value.replace(/\D+/g,'')" class="form-control" value="{if empty($membership['displayorder'])}0{else}{$membership['displayorder']}{/if}" />
</div>
<div class="help-block">请填写数字,前台显示为Lv.1-lv.n级,判断自动升级的字段。</div>
</div>
<div class="form-group">
<label class="col-xs-12 col-sm-3 col-md-2 control-label"><span style='color:red'>*</span>等级名称</label>
<div class="col-sm-4 col-xs-12">
<input type="text" name="member_name" id="member_name" class="form-control" value="{$membership['member_name']}" />
</div>
</div>
<div class="form-group">
<label class="col-xs-12 col-sm-3 col-md-2 control-label">所需交易额</label>
<div class="col-sm-2 col-xs-2">
<div class="input-group">
<input type="text" onkeyup="value=this.value.replace(/\D+/g,'')" name="member_turnover" id="member_turnover" class="form-control" value="{if empty($membership['member_turnover'])}0{else}{php echo number_format($membership['member_turnover'],0,'','')}{/if}" />
<span class="input-group-addon">元</span>
</div>
</div>
<div class="help-block">为0则不判断交易额</div>
</div>
<div class="form-group">
<label class="col-xs-12 col-sm-3 col-md-2 control-label">或所需成交单数</label>
<div class="col-sm-2 col-xs-2">
<div class="input-group">
<input type="text" onkeyup="value=this.value.replace(/\D+/g,'')" name="member_motercount" id="member_motercount" class="form-control" value="{if empty($membership['member_motercount'])}0{else}{$membership['member_motercount']}{/if}" />
<span class="input-group-addon">单</span>
</div>
</div>
<div class="help-block">为0则不判断成交单数</div>
</div>
<div class="form-group">
<label class="col-xs-12 col-sm-3 col-md-2 control-label">享受折扣</label>
<div class="col-sm-2 col-xs-2">
<div class="input-group">
<input type="text" onkeyup="value=this.value.replace(/\D+/g,'')" name="member_commission" id="member_commission" class="form-control" cols="60" value="{if $membership['member_commission']<=10}10{else}{$membership['member_commission']}{/if}" />
<span class="input-group-addon">%</span>
</div>
</div>
<div class="help-block">最低折扣率10%</div>
</div>
<div class="form-group">
<label class="col-xs-12 col-sm-3 col-md-2 control-label">订单状态</label>
<div class="col-sm-8 col-xs-12">
<label class="radio-inline"><input type="radio" name="promoterstate" value="1" {if $membership['promoterstate'] == 1} checked="checked"{/if} /> 付款后</label>
<label class="radio-inline"><input type="radio" name="promoterstate" value="0" {if $membership['promoterstate'] == 0} checked="checked"{/if} /> 订单完成后</label>
<div class="help-block">当满足以上条件时才能加入此会员等级,默认订单完成后!</div>
</div>
</div>
<div class="form-group">
<label class="col-xs-12 col-sm-3 col-md-2 control-label"></label>
<div class="col-sm-6 col-xs-6">
<input name="submit" type="submit" value="提交" class="btn btn-primary span3">
<input type="hidden" name="token" value="{$_W['token']}" />
</div>
</div>
</form>
</div>
</div>
</div>
{elseif $operation == 'display'}
<div class="main">
<div class="alert alert-info">
说明:系统设置中允许自动升级后,会员将按设置级别自小往上自动升级。<a class="label label-success" href="{php echo $this->createWebUrl('fansmanager', array('op' => 'autouser'))}">更新全体用户等级、代理等级以及下级数量(操作数据缓慢请勿关闭网页)</a>
</div>
<div class="panel panel-info">
<div class="panel-heading">会员等级列表</div>
<div class="panel-body">
<form action="" method="post">
<table class="table table-hover">
<thead>
<tr>
<th style="width:10px;"></th>
<th style="width:50px;">级别</th>
<th style="width:120px;">等级名称</th>
<th style="width:80px;">所需交易额</th>
<th style="width:80px;">或所需成交单数</th>
<th style="width:80px;">享受折扣</th>
<th style="width:80px;">满足/总数量</th>
<th style="width:80px;">订单状态</th>
<th style="width:80px;">操作</th>
</tr>
</thead>
<tbody>
{loop $list $row}
<tr>
<td></td>
<td>Lv.{$row['displayorder']}</td>
<td>{$row['member_name']}</td>
<td>{$row['member_turnover']}</td>
<td>{$row['member_motercount']}</td>
<td>{php echo $row['member_commission']/10} 折</td>
<td><a href="{php echo $this->createWebUrl('charge', array('op' => 'list', 'submit'=>'搜 索', 'usergrade'=>$row['id']))}"><span class="label label-success" style="cursor:pointer;">{php echo $this->getFansSum($row['id'])}/{php echo $this->getFansZongSum($row['id'])}</span></a></td>
<td>{if $row['promoterstate'] == 1}<span class="label label-success" style="cursor:pointer;">订单付款后</span>{else}<span class="label label-danger" style="cursor:pointer;">订单完成后</span>{/if}</td>
<td>
<a class="btn btn-default btn-sm" href="{php echo $this->createWebUrl('membershipgrade', array('op' => 'post', 'id' => $row['id']))}"><i class="fa fa-edit"></i> 编辑</a>
<a class="btn btn-default btn-sm" href="{php echo $this->createWebUrl('membershipgrade', array('op' => 'delete', 'id' => $row['id']))}" onclick="return confirm('确认删除此会员等级,确认吗?');return false;"><i class="fa fa-times"></i> 删除</a>
</td>
</tr>
{/loop}
<tr>
<td></td>
<td colspan="7">
<a href="{php echo $this->createWebUrl('membershipgrade', array('op' => 'post'))}"><i class="fa fa-plus-square"></i> 添加新等级</a>
</td>
</tr>
<tr>
<td></td>
<td colspan="7">
<input name="submit" type="submit" class="btn btn-primary" value="提交">
<input type="hidden" name="token" value="{$_W['token']}" />
</td>
</tr>
</tbody>
</table>
</form>
</div>
</div>
</div>
{/if}
<script language='javascript'>
function formcheck() {
if ($("#displayorder").val()==0 || $("#displayorder").isEmpty()) {
Tip.focus("displayorder", "级别不能为0或为空!", "right");
return false;
}
if ($("#member_name").isEmpty()) {
Tip.focus("member_name", "请填写会员等级名称!", "right");
return false;
}
if (!$("#member_turnover").isNumber()) {
Tip.select("member_turnover", "请填写所需交易额!", "right");
return false;
}
if (!$("#member_motercount").isNumber()) {
Tip.select("member_motercount", "请填写所需成交单数!", "right");
return false;
}
if (!$("#member_commission").isNumber()) {
Tip.select("member_commission", "请填写折扣率!", "right");
return false;
}
if ($("#member_commission").val() < 10 || $("#member_commission").val() > 100) {
Tip.select("member_commission", "折扣率不能低于1折也不能大于10折!", "right");
return false;
}
return true;
}
</script>
{template 'common/footer'}